Yamaha Banshee 350 Top Speed : How Fast Can It Genuinely Go?
The iconic Yamaha Banshee 350 enjoys a claim for being incredibly nimble, but what's its actual top speed ? Generally , a Yamaha banshee 450 stock Banshee 350, with its original gearing and setup, can hit a highest speed of around 58 miles per hour on a smooth surface. However, this reading is highly adjustable based on factors like rubber condition, altitude, operator weight, and any modifications performed to the ATV . With aftermarket modifications like exhaust systems, reeds, and changed gearing, some riders have reportedly pushed the machine to speeds exceeding 70 miles per hour , making it a truly thrilling ride.
Yamaha Banshee 350cc Value Overview: Which to Anticipate
Determining the fair price of a Yamaha Banshee can be difficult, given its history and demand as a iconic machine. Usually, you can find examples ranging from around $1500 for a project unit needing restoration, to upwards of $5000 or more for a pristine unit with limited use. State, mechanical health, and existence of original parts all significantly impact the final price. Do not overlook that rare editions or modified Banshees can attract a premium cost.

Typical Concerns & Care for Your YZ 350 Banshee
Owning a legendary Yamaha Banshee presents distinct rewards, but also some challenges. Often encountered issues include worn reed valves, failing crank seals, and difficulties with the carburetor(s). Scheduled maintenance is vital to maintaining your quad's condition. This involves regular assessments of the chain, air filter, and ignition system. Don't ignoring liquid flushes, and consider upgrading pieces like the radiator for increased longevity. Addressing minor aspects proactively will allow you to enjoy long and dependable riding adventure.
